The growing interest in angle side triangles in the US can be attributed to several factors. Advances in mathematics education, more open approaches to learning, and a renewed focus on critical thinking skills are driving the need for a deeper understanding of fundamental mathematical concepts. This shift towards exploring the fascinating aspects of geometry is gaining momentum, and the hidden geometry of angle side triangles has become a prime region to explore.

Simply put, a triangle has three sides (its perimeter) and three angles. While the perimeter sums are straightforward, the relationships between the angles have captivated mathematicians for centuries. For any angle side triangle, the law of cosines helps quantify the relationship between the sides, angles, and the triangle's geometry. The formula a^2 = b^2 + c^2 - 2bc * cosΑ (where 'a
